This video has been the hardest but most rewarding project yet. The Common Skate is the largest non- migratory fish living in UK waters and from my experience is fairly unknown to the general public. I hadn't known about this fish until recently but as soon as I discovered there were fish which could weigh more than me - I had to catch one.     I first fished Fast Castle about 15 years ago and it was almost my last trip. It is a super dangerous place to tackle unless you know exactly what you're doing, and know how to get yourself out of the trouble that you will almost definetly get in to. I only ever fish it from a kayak now, but only after spending quite a lot of time researching tides and swells. It's not a place you can just rock up to and cast a line.

    Two tips. When they suck onto the bottom like that, pull the line taut and then pluck it. (They have the line in their mouth, underneath the body, and it's going up to you. When you pluck that line, it flicks them around the face and upsets them, often making them move. Same trick works with rays.) The other tip is a something many fishermen are forgetting as reels get better. The name Angling comes from the angle between the water level and the line which you create using the rod. The rod is then a big, flexible shock absorber. The line is a relatively inflexible cord. The reel has a drag that lets the fish pull out more line rather than break it. The missing link is using the rod to make it harder for the fish to take line. When a big fish runs, you want to lean back and try to get the rod tip as high as you can. Then, to pull more line, the fish first has to bend the rod over so there's no more give, at which point then it can pull more line off the reel. The rod is meant to take a lot of the energy out of the run, making the fish work even harder for every inch of line, wearing it down faster until eventually you can land it. When the only drag a reel had was the fisherman's hand slowing it down, using the rod this way was a lot more important, but for big fish it's still an important principle of fishing to bring into play.
